Cultural insights in Cha-Am offer travelers a chance to explore the town's rich heritage and local lifestyle through various unique aspects: 1. Traditional Fishing Community: Engage with local fishermen to learn traditional fishing methods and enjoy fresh seafood reflecting the area's culinary heritage. 2. Community Spirit: Visit local markets, like the Cha-Am Wednesday Night Market, to interact with friendly locals and experience daily life through authentic Thai street food and handmade crafts. 3. Temples and Spirituality: Explore significant sites like Wat Cha-Am and participate in cultural celebrations to understand the local Buddhist practices. 4. Agricultural Influence: Discover the surrounding farming communities, taste seasonal products at markets, and learn about agricultural practices that support the economy. 5. Arts and Crafts: Meet local artisans, appreciate traditional crafts, and participate in workshops that connect you with the area's cultural heritage. 6. Culinary Experiences: Take part in cooking classes to learn traditional Thai dishes and explore Cha-Am's street food culture for a taste of local flavors. 7. Festivals and Celebrations: Join local festivals like Loy Krathong and Songkran for immersive cultural experiences that include traditional music, dance, and food. 8. Environmental and Eco Awareness: Learn about sustainable practices within the community and explore local parks to understand the relationship between culture and nature.
